
Last night, the authorities were alerted to a tragic incident involving a pedestrian and a vehicle. The collision occurred in the vicinity of Telegraph Canyon Road and Paseo Ranchero. According to the Chula Vista Police Department, emergency calls occurred around 10:15 pm on September 26th, drawing attention to the accident.
A passenger vehicle had struck an individual standing on the 1000 block of Telegraph Canyon Road. Despite efforts by witnesses and emergency services to provide first aid, the pedestrian, estimated to be between 20-25 years old, was pronounced dead at the scene, their identity still unknown. The driver, a 69-year-old local of Chula Vista, remained after the accident and cooperated with law enforcement.
Adding to the urgency of late-night traffic accidents, the Chula Vista Traffic Bureau has taken the lead in investigating the circumstances of the collision. They have yet to make a final statement on what caused the tragic event. Preliminary assessments, however, indicate that alcohol was likely not a factor in the incident.
